WebJun 13, 2011 · The created pyvenv.cfg file also includes the include-system-site-packages key, set to true if pyvenv is run with the --system-site-packages option, false by default. Multiple paths can be given to pyvenv, in which case an identical venv will be created, according to the given options, at each provided path. In this environment, pip is installed as a local copy but the interpreter is a symlink. Finally, the environment includes a pyvenv.cfg file with settings describing how the environment is configured and should behave.
